1

我使用 AWS EC2 免费套餐和 Elastic Beanstalk。我还没有从 AWS 购买任何服务。

当我以 root 身份登录时,AWS 通知我将超出免费套餐使用限制:

在此处输入图像描述

我想看报告。我做了所有这些文档所说的https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/usage-reports-instance.html#viewing-instance-usage 但 AWS 没有向我显示报告。我正确设置了所有必要的过滤器:

在此处输入图像描述

为什么?如何让 AWS 显示报告?

4

1 回答 1

1

我想通了。

我还没有明确使用过任何 AWS 存储服务。我现在只测试 Elastic Beanstalk 以掌握 AWS。Docs 说 Beanstalk 是免费的,您只需为 Beanstalk 使用的 AWS 资源付费。而且 Beanstalk 总是t2.micro为我的 Node.js Web 服务器创建免费实例,而且我从来没有对我的示例测试应用程序提出过限制请求。但是,我经常将我的应用程序的新版本作为.zip捆绑包上传。那个 Elastic Beanstalk 为此向我收费!11 月,它突然向我收取 2 美元的S3使用费。我从未使用过S3,但 Beanstalk 做到了。默默。

小心玩豆茎。S3Beanstalk在幕后发出所有这些 PUT 请求。

它最好EC2 instanceEBS storage. EBS 免费提供:

2 000 000 I/O 操作(仅 S3 20 000 GET,2000 PUT)

30 Gb 存储(仅 S3 5Gb)

1 Gb 用于快照(S3 没有)

对于开发和测试环境来说,免费EBS General Purpose (SSD)就足够了。但 Beanstalk 不使用它。它使用昂贵的S3.

于 2015-12-03T02:44:05.497 回答